Buyer’s Guide: How to Choose the Right Non-Toxic Dishwasher Tablet

Choosing the best non-toxic dishwasher detergent depends on your household’s specific needs, from your water hardness to your personal sustainability goals. This guide will walk you through the key factors I considered in my testing, empowering you to select the perfect product with confidence.

  • Ingredients to Look For (and Avoid): This is the most critical factor. I always look for a clean, transparent ingredient list that features plant and mineral-based cleaners and powerful enzymes. I recommend you always avoid chlorine bleach, phosphates (which are harmful to aquatic life), phthalates, and harsh synthetic fragrances and dyes.
  • Cleaning Performance & Enzymes: A “non-toxic” label is meaningless if the product doesn’t actually clean your dishes. Look for formulas that specifically mention “enzymes” or an “enzyme-rich” blend. These are natural proteins that are brilliant at breaking down and dissolving food starches and proteins without the need for harsh, corrosive chemicals.
  • Packaging & Sustainability Goals: Your choice here depends on what “eco-friendly” means to you. If you’re aiming for a zero-waste household, a plastic-free option with naked tablets like BLUELAND is your best bet. If reducing your overall carbon footprint is your main priority, a super-concentrated tablet like If You Care is an excellent choice.
  • Third-Party Certifications: These are your proof of a brand’s claims. I place a high value on EPA Safer Choice, which certifies that a product is safer for human health and the environment. Leaping Bunny is the gold standard for guaranteeing a product is cruelty-free. Certifications like B Corp and Climate Neutral are also outstanding indicators of a brand’s deep ethical and environmental commitment.
  • Scented vs. Unscented: This is purely a personal preference. If you or a family member has allergies, sensitive skin, or fragrance sensitivities, I strongly recommend a “Fragrance-Free” or “Free & Clear” option. If you enjoy a fresh scent in your kitchen, look for products scented with natural essential oils or plant extracts, like the Lemon Verbena in The Clean People.
  • Hard Water Compatibility: If you live in an area with hard water, you know the struggle with cloudy glasses and white mineral buildup. Non-toxic detergents that are effective against hard water will often mention it on their packaging. They typically use natural agents like citric acid to act as a water softener, preventing spots and ensuring a streak-free shine.
  • Tablet, Pod, or Powder?: For this review, I focused on tablets and pods because they are pre-measured, convenient, and reduce overuse. “Naked” tablets are best for zero-waste goals. Pods encased in a dissolvable PVA film are convenient and mess-free, and the film is designed to be biodegradable.

What ingredients should I avoid in dishwasher detergent?

I recommend actively avoiding several ingredients: phosphates, chlorine bleach, phthalates, artificial dyes, and synthetic fragrances. These ingredients can be irritating to the skin, are known to be harmful to aquatic ecosystems, and are simply unnecessary for achieving an effective, sparkling clean.

Can you use non-toxic dishwasher detergent in hard water?

Yes, many non-toxic detergents are specifically formulated to work well in hard water. Look for products that mention “hard water performance” or contain natural ingredients like citric acid. These agents help to chelate minerals, preventing the white, cloudy film and spotting that hard water can leave on glassware.

What is the difference between non-toxic pods and powder?

Pods and tablets are pre-measured single doses, which is incredibly convenient and helps prevent overuse of detergent. Powders offer more flexibility, allowing you to adjust the amount of detergent used per load, but they can be messier to handle. Both can be excellent non-toxic options, but pods offer superior ease of use.

Do non-toxic dishwasher tablets leave streaks?

High-quality non-toxic tablets are formulated to rinse completely clean and leave your dishes streak-free. If you are experiencing streaks or a cloudy film, it could be due to exceptionally hard water in your area or consistently overloading your dishwasher. Using a natural rinse aid can also help ensure a perfect, sparkling finish.

What certifications should I look for in non-toxic detergents?

I recommend looking for a few key third-party certifications to ensure a product’s claims are valid. The most important are EPA Safer Choice, Leaping Bunny (cruelty-free), and USDA Certified Biobased Product. For brands with a deep commitment to sustainability and ethics, also look for Certified B Corporation and Climate Neutral certifications.
